Remeron is very effective in inducing sleep. Unfortunately it can make you groggy throughout the day, until you become used to its effects. It also has no addiction potential, but can produce withdrawl symptoms if discontinued abruptly.
 
^^^
This is true...however in my personal experience Remeron produced no withdrawal symptoms whatsoever. I was taking 60 mg/day for 7 weeks and stopped abruptly with no ill effects. It does not seem to cause withdrawal effects nearly as much as most other antidepressants.
